Appropriate Preposition:

  • Certain of ( নিশ্চিত ) He is now certain of his ground.
  • Complain to ( অভিযোগ করা (ব্যক্তি) ) The complained to the Director against the Manager about her behavior.
  • Aim at ( লক্ষ্য করা ) He aimed his gun at he bird.
  • Attend to ( মনোযোগ দেওয়া ) Attend to your lesson.
  • Pity for ( করুণা ) Have pity for the poor.
  • Cope with ( সামলানো ) I cannot cope with the situation.

Idioms:

  • At least ( অন্ততঃ ) At least one hundred boys will come to school today.
  • To and fro ( এদিন-ওদিক ) Being unable to make up his mind the man is walking to and fro.
  • In fine ( পরিশেষ ) In fine he declared his plan.
  • By leaps and bounds ( অতি দ্রুতগতিতে ) The population of Bangladesh is increasing by leaps and bounds.
  • Flesh and blood ( রক্তমাংসের শরীর ) Flesh and blood cannot bear with such insults.
  • Out of temper ( ক্রুদ্ধ ) He is out of temper now.
